SERVICE BULLETIN
APPLICABILITY:
NUMBER: 12-151-13R
DATE: 05/07/13
REVISED: 10/30/13
2014MY Forester Models
SUBJECT:	Increase to Detent Force of Front Door
Checker Mechanism
INTRODUCTION
If you receive a customer concern of the front door checkers not holding the doors securely enough
in the half or fully open positions, this bulletin informs of a change which adds 2 additional holding
positions and an increase to the detent force of the front door checker mechanism. The new door
checker provides a more positive feeling when holding the front doors in partially open positions.
New part: 61124SG003
Old part: 61124SG002, 000
Three detent positions
One detent position
COUNTERMEASURE IN PRODUCTION
The new door checker mechanisms were incorporated into production on October 10, 2013 starting
with VIN E*508768.
PART INFORMATION
NOTE: The same part number is used for both the left and right front doors.
